[CI 6/6] drm/xe/pmu: Add GT C6 events

Provide a PMU interface for GT C6 residency counters. The interface is
similar to the one available for i915, but gt is passed in the config
when creating the event.
Sample usage and output:
$ perf list | grep gt-c6
xe_0000_00_02.0/gt-c6-residency/ [Kernel PMU event]
$ tail /sys/bus/event_source/devices/xe_0000_00_02.0/events/gt-c6-residency*
==> /sys/bus/event_source/devices/xe_0000_00_02.0/events/gt-c6-residency <==
event=0x01
==> /sys/bus/event_source/devices/xe_0000_00_02.0/events/gt-c6-residency.unit <==
ms
$ perf stat -e xe_0000_00_02.0/gt-c6-residency,gt=0/ -I1000
# time counts unit events
1.001196056 1,001 ms xe_0000_00_02.0/gt-c6-residency,gt=0/
2.005216219 1,003 ms xe_0000_00_02.0/gt-c6-residency,gt=0/
